Selecting an Employment Attorney: Important Questions to Raise

When encountering an work law matter, selecting the appropriate attorney is crucial. Avoid rushing the decision ; rather , prepare a list of concerns to evaluate their expertise . In particular , determine about their background handling related situations . Also , discover their fee system – by the hour , contingency , or a set price. Lastly, discuss their communication style and whether they plan to provide you updated of your matter.

Employment Lawyer vs. Employment Attorney: Do you know the Difference ?

You’ve come across the copyright “ job lawyer” and “ work attorney” and questioned if there's a true variation between them. The response is, in virtually all situations, they are functionally synonymous . Both describe a legal who specializes in labor rules. Think of it like this: “lawyer” is a broad term for anyone licensed to represent clients. An “attorney” is a person who is formally engaged in rendering counsel. So , an employment attorney is simply an work lawyer, to the same effect.
